Description

Explore the massive scale and impact of the 2010 Shanghai Expo through this Routledge publication. As one of the largest and most expensive world fairs in history, the event attracted 73 million visitors and cost approximately USUSD45 billion. This book examines how the expo addressed the pressing challenges of the 21st century under the theme "Better City, Better Life." With more than half of the global population now residing in urban environments, many of which face uncertain futures, this text provides a deep look into how mega events shape our understanding of urban development. Following the Beijing Olympics, the Shanghai Expo represented a significant moment in history, focusing on the evolution of cities and the needs of humanity. This is an essential resource for those interested in anthropology, sociology, and the future of global urban life.
